Non Renewable Energy Impact on Environment

All energy sources have some impact on our environment. Fossil fuels—coal, oil, and natural gas—do substantially more harm than renewable energy sources by most measures, including air and water pollution, damage to public health, wildlife and habitat loss, water use, land use, and global warming emissions.

True or false: In a gel electrophoresis gel, a DNA fragment containing 100 bp (base pairs) would travel faster (and further) tha
vova2212 [387]

Answer: true

Explanation: In gel electrophoresis, the smaller the size/molecular weight of DNA the faster it moves across the gel and vise versa. This is as a result of the pore size of the gel which is usually prepared 1g of agarose in 100ml of distilled water. So a DNA fragment with 1000 base pairs will "struggle" its movement across the gel pore making it mive less faster and further. Movement and molecular weight of DNA are inversely proportional.

When the archer releases the arrow, the [blank] energy in the bow string transforms into [blank] energy for the arrow.
Kobotan [32]

Answer:

potential energy, kinetic energy

Explanation:

potential energy is the energy held by an object because of its position. kinetic energy is energy in motion. when the bow is being drawn back it has potential energy because of its position and that at any moment it can be converted into kinetic energy.
